With 60 challenges, the game offers lots of creative building time, but only one design will successfully carry the marble directly to the target. Played solo, Gravity Maze engages kids ages 8 and up in building and solving as they arrange colorful, translucent towers to whisk their marble from starting point to target using engineering, visual perception and reasoning skills. “We’re very honored that support for Gravity Maze and Laser Maze extends beyond our passionate fans and the industry to educators and the media.”įinalist for Specialty Toy of the Year, Gravity Maze is the only marble run with a logic puzzle. ![]() “It’s doubly rewarding to have two games up for Toy of the Year,” said Andrea Barthello, ThinkFun Chief Operating Officer and Co-Founder. This year’s finalists were selected from more than 600 nominees by 60 academics, journalists, toy trend experts, play therapists, toy inventors and designers, and toy retailers. Well-known as the “Oscars” of the toy industry, Toy of the Year awards are issued by the Toy Industry Association and represent favorite toys, games, and properties across 12 categories.
